Partilhar via


Workspace interface

Representa uma definição de espaço de trabalho.

Extends

Propriedades

applicationGroupReferences

Lista de IDs de recurso applicationGroup.

cloudPcResource

É recurso de pc em nuvem. Observação : esta propriedade não será serializada. Ele só pode ser preenchido pelo servidor.

description

Descrição do espaço de trabalho.

friendlyName

Nome amigável do espaço de trabalho.

objectId

ObjectId do espaço de trabalho. (utilização interna) Observação : esta propriedade não será serializada. Ele só pode ser preenchido pelo servidor.

privateEndpointConnections

Lista de conexão de ponto de extremidade privada associada ao recurso especificado NOTA: Esta propriedade não será serializada. Ele só pode ser preenchido pelo servidor.

publicNetworkAccess

Ativado permite que este recurso seja acedido a partir de redes públicas e privadas, Desativado permite que este recurso só seja acedido através de terminais privados

Propriedades Herdadas

etag

O campo etag não é obrigatório. Se for fornecido no corpo da resposta, também deve ser fornecido como um cabeçalho de acordo com a convenção etag normal. As tags de entidade são usadas para comparar duas ou mais entidades do mesmo recurso solicitado. HTTP/1.1 usa tags de entidade nos campos de cabeçalho etag (seção 14.19), If-Match (seção 14.24), If-None-Match (seção 14.26) e If-Range (seção 14.27). Observação : esta propriedade não será serializada. Ele só pode ser preenchido pelo servidor.

id

ID de recurso totalmente qualificado para o recurso. Por exemplo, "/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{resourceType}/{resourceName}" NOTA: Esta propriedade não será serializada. Ele só pode ser preenchido pelo servidor.

identity
kind

Metadados usados pelo portal/ferramenta/etc para renderizar diferentes experiências de UX para recursos do mesmo tipo. Por exemplo, ApiApps são um tipo de Microsoft.Web/sites. Se houver suporte, o provedor de recursos deverá validar e persistir esse valor.

location

A geolocalização onde o recurso vive

managedBy

A ID de recurso totalmente qualificada do recurso que gerencia esse recurso. Indica se esse recurso é gerenciado por outro recurso do Azure. Se isso estiver presente, a implantação em modo completo não excluirá o recurso se ele for removido do modelo, uma vez que é gerenciado por outro recurso.

name

O nome do recurso NOTA: Esta propriedade não será serializada. Ele só pode ser preenchido pelo servidor.

plan
sku
systemData

Metadados do Azure Resource Manager contendo informações createdBy e modifiedBy. Observação : esta propriedade não será serializada. Ele só pode ser preenchido pelo servidor.

tags

Tags de recursos.

type

O tipo do recurso. Por exemplo, "Microsoft.Compute/virtualMachines" ou "Microsoft.Storage/storageAccounts" NOTA: Esta propriedade não será serializada. Ele só pode ser preenchido pelo servidor.

Detalhes de Propriedade

applicationGroupReferences

Lista de IDs de recurso applicationGroup.

applicationGroupReferences?: string[]

Valor de Propriedade

string[]

cloudPcResource

É recurso de pc em nuvem. Observação : esta propriedade não será serializada. Ele só pode ser preenchido pelo servidor.

cloudPcResource?: boolean

Valor de Propriedade

boolean

description

Descrição do espaço de trabalho.

description?: string

Valor de Propriedade

string

friendlyName

Nome amigável do espaço de trabalho.

friendlyName?: string

Valor de Propriedade

string

objectId

ObjectId do espaço de trabalho. (utilização interna) Observação : esta propriedade não será serializada. Ele só pode ser preenchido pelo servidor.

objectId?: string

Valor de Propriedade

string

privateEndpointConnections

Lista de conexão de ponto de extremidade privada associada ao recurso especificado NOTA: Esta propriedade não será serializada. Ele só pode ser preenchido pelo servidor.

privateEndpointConnections?: PrivateEndpointConnection[]

Valor de Propriedade

publicNetworkAccess

Ativado permite que este recurso seja acedido a partir de redes públicas e privadas, Desativado permite que este recurso só seja acedido através de terminais privados

publicNetworkAccess?: string

Valor de Propriedade

string

Detalhes da Propriedade Herdada

etag

O campo etag não é obrigatório. Se for fornecido no corpo da resposta, também deve ser fornecido como um cabeçalho de acordo com a convenção etag normal. As tags de entidade são usadas para comparar duas ou mais entidades do mesmo recurso solicitado. HTTP/1.1 usa tags de entidade nos campos de cabeçalho etag (seção 14.19), If-Match (seção 14.24), If-None-Match (seção 14.26) e If-Range (seção 14.27). Observação : esta propriedade não será serializada. Ele só pode ser preenchido pelo servidor.

etag?: string

Valor de Propriedade

string

herdado de ResourceModelWithAllowedPropertySet.etag

id

ID de recurso totalmente qualificado para o recurso. Por exemplo, "/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{resourceType}/{resourceName}" NOTA: Esta propriedade não será serializada. Ele só pode ser preenchido pelo servidor.

id?: string

Valor de Propriedade

string

herdada deResourceModelWithAllowedPropertySet.id

identity

identity?: ResourceModelWithAllowedPropertySetIdentity

Valor de Propriedade

herdada de ResourceModelWithAllowedPropertySet.identity

kind

Metadados usados pelo portal/ferramenta/etc para renderizar diferentes experiências de UX para recursos do mesmo tipo. Por exemplo, ApiApps são um tipo de Microsoft.Web/sites. Se houver suporte, o provedor de recursos deverá validar e persistir esse valor.

kind?: string

Valor de Propriedade

string

herdada deResourceModelWithAllowedPropertySet.kind

location

A geolocalização onde o recurso vive

location: string

Valor de Propriedade

string

herdada de ResourceModelWithAllowedPropertySet.location

managedBy

A ID de recurso totalmente qualificada do recurso que gerencia esse recurso. Indica se esse recurso é gerenciado por outro recurso do Azure. Se isso estiver presente, a implantação em modo completo não excluirá o recurso se ele for removido do modelo, uma vez que é gerenciado por outro recurso.

managedBy?: string

Valor de Propriedade

string

herdado deResourceModelWithAllowedPropertySet.managedBy

name

O nome do recurso NOTA: Esta propriedade não será serializada. Ele só pode ser preenchido pelo servidor.

name?: string

Valor de Propriedade

string

herdada deResourceModelWithAllowedPropertySet.name

plan

plan?: ResourceModelWithAllowedPropertySetPlan

Valor de Propriedade

herdado de ResourceModelWithAllowedPropertySet.plan

sku

sku?: ResourceModelWithAllowedPropertySetSku

Valor de Propriedade

herdado de ResourceModelWithAllowedPropertySet.sku

systemData

Metadados do Azure Resource Manager contendo informações createdBy e modifiedBy. Observação : esta propriedade não será serializada. Ele só pode ser preenchido pelo servidor.

systemData?: SystemData

Valor de Propriedade

herdado deResourceModelWithAllowedPropertySet.systemData

tags

Tags de recursos.

tags?: {[propertyName: string]: string}

Valor de Propriedade

{[propertyName: string]: string}

herdado deResourceModelWithAllowedPropertySet.tags

type

O tipo do recurso. Por exemplo, "Microsoft.Compute/virtualMachines" ou "Microsoft.Storage/storageAccounts" NOTA: Esta propriedade não será serializada. Ele só pode ser preenchido pelo servidor.

type?: string

Valor de Propriedade

string

herdada de ResourceModelWithAllowedPropertySet.type